Here’s How Many Shares of MPLX You’d Need for $1,000 in Yearly Dividends

MPLX, a master limited partnership (MLP), is known for its high current yield backed by stable cash flows and a robust financial profile. The company recently increased its distribution payment by 12.5%, showcasing its strong position to continue growing its high-yielding payout in the future.

With a current distribution yield of 7.7%, MPLX offers a substantial return on investment compared to the S&P 500’s dividend yield of 1.1%. This makes it an attractive option for investors looking to generate passive income. To illustrate, an investment in MPLX can provide $1,000 of annual income by owning 232 units of the MLP, costing around $13,000 at the recent unit price of $56.

Unlike some high-yielding dividend stocks, MPLX maintains a low-risk profile due to its midstream operations that generate stable cash flow from long-term contracts and government-regulated rate structures. The company’s conservative financial approach ensures it can cover its distribution payment comfortably, with a leverage ratio below the industry standard.

Furthermore, MPLX has the financial flexibility to pursue acquisitions and invest in expansion projects. The company has a robust backlog of organic capital projects scheduled to come online through 2029, providing a solid foundation for future growth. MPLX has a track record of increasing its distribution every year since its inception in 2012, with a compound annual growth rate of 11.6% since 2022.
